Está en la página 1de 17

Componente practico

Federico Parra Medina, federparralds@gmail.com

Análisis y Especificación de Requerimientos 202016894

Docente: Edna Rocío Rodríguez Escandon.

Universidad Nacional Abierta y a Distancia UNAD

Vicerrectoría de Desarrollo Regional y Proyección Comunitaria VIDER

Fundamentos y Generalidades de la Investigación

Zona (zur)

2023

Contenido
Introducción................................................................................................................................2
Objetivos del trabajo.................................................................................................................3
Herramienta de Gestión de Requisitos (REM)......................................................................5
Herramienta de Diagramación: DIA........................................................................................6
Especificación de requerimientos y casos de uso................................................................7
1 Requistos funcionales...........................................................................................................7
1.1 Casos de uso.................................................................................................................10
Diagrama de caso de uso......................................................................................................16
Conclusión................................................................................................................................16
Conclusiones Bibliografía.......................................................................................................17

Introducción

En documento se propondrá el desarrollo de un software, que sirvira para


agilizar la forma de gestionar los torneos en el colegio Nacional de Ajedrez.
Esta iniciativa busca optimizar la gestión interna del colegio en cuanto a
eventos de ajedrez, además también enriquecer la experiencia de los
jugadores, brindándoles una plataforma digital intuitiva. A lo largo de este
trabajo, se detallarán el requisito funcional y no funcional, así como los casos
de uso y un diagrama representativo de estos casos, todo esto ayudara a que
nuestro proyecto sea exitoso.

Objetivos del trabajo

Objetivo general

Este proyecto tiene como objetivo principal modernizar y optimizar las


operaciones del Colegio Nacional de Ajedrez a través de la implementación de
un sistema informático especializado. Los objetivos específicos son los
siguientes:

Objetivo especifico

 Reducir la dependencia de procesos manuales al implementar un


sistema que automatizado

 Proporcionar herramientas digitales que agilicen la planificación y


gestión de torneos.

 Facilitar el acceso a datos relevantes al ofrecer una plataforma en línea


que permita a jugadores y organizadores acceder a información clave en
cualquier momento.

 Desarrollar el sistema de manera que sea flexible y pueda adaptarse.

Herramienta de Gestión de Requisitos (REM)


La herramienta de Gestión de Requisitos, conocida como REM y desarrollada
por el Dr. Amador Duran, se presenta como una solución integral para la
planificación y documentación de proyectos de software. Sus características
distintivas la convierten en una opción altamente efectiva para equipos de
desarrollo. REM permite:

 Crear Requisitos
 Seguimiento de Cambios en Requisitos
 Historial de Versiones

Herramienta de Diagramación: DIA

DIA se presenta como una herramienta de diagramación de código abierto,


destacando por su eficacia y facilidad de uso en la creación de diversos tipos
de diagramas. A continuación, se describen algunas de sus características de
DIA:

 Variedad de Diagramas:
 Compatibilidad de Formatos de Archivo:
 Personalización de Elementos:

Es una herramienta completa y accesible para la creación de diagramas en


diversos contextos, destacando por su compatibilidad de formatos, interfaz
intuitiva y capacidad para abordar una amplia gama de necesidades de
representación visual en el ámbito de la ingeniería de software y más allá.

Entorno DIA

Especificación de requerimientos y casos de uso

1 Requistos funcionales
FRQ-0004 Control de campeonatos
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[UC-0001] Gestion de partcipantes

Descripción El sistema deberá debe permitir a los administradores registrar


nuevos campeonatos de ajedrez.

Importancia importante

Urgencia inmediatamente

Estado en construcción

Estabilidad media

Comentarios Ninguno

FRQ-0002 Asesoría de campeonatos

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[UC-0002] Asesoria de Campeonatos

Descripción El sistema deberá debe posibilitar la asesoría de información


acerca de los campeonatos, los
resultados, las clasificaciones y por ende las premiaciones
para los usuarios en general.

Importancia importante

Urgencia inmediatamente

Estado en construcción
Estabilidad PD

Comentarios Ninguno

FRQ-0001 Actualización de Información

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[UC-0003] actualizacion de la informacion

Descripción El sistema deberá debe posibilitar la actualización de la


información de los equipos, jugadores, y
los resultados arrojados de las partidas por parte de aquellos
usuarios que este
autorizados.

Importancia vital

Urgencia inmediatamente

Estado en construcción

Estabilidad alta

Comentarios Ninguno

FRQ-0003 Preservación de Información

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[UC-0004] Preservacion de la informacion


Descripción El sistema deberá debe de preservar información pertinente
de los campeonatos de ajedrez; tales
como los datos de los jugadores, de los equipos, los
resultados las clasificaciones y
premiaciones.

Importancia importante

Urgencia inmediatamente

Estado en construcción

Estabilidad media

Comentarios Ninguno

1.1 Casos de uso


UC-0001 Gestion de partcipantes

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[FRQ-0004] Control de campeonatos

Descripción El sistema deberá comportarse tal como se describe en el


siguiente caso de uso cuando permitir la inscripción y gestión
de jugadores y equipos al torneo.

Precondición El administrador tiene acceso al sistema para agregar a un


nuevo participante o equipo.

Secuencia Paso Acción


normal
1 El actor Administrador del sistema (ACT-0001) Ingresa
al módulo de administración de campeonatos.

2 El actor Participante (ACT-0002) completar el formulario


con datos del particpante.

3 El sistema confirmar y almacenar la información del


nuevo participante o equipo, al torneo.

Postcondición Se ha creado un nuevo registro de campeonato con la


información proporcionada.

Excepciones Paso Acción

3 Si los datos son erroneos, el sistema generara un error,


a continuación este caso de uso PD

Rendimiento Paso Tiempo máximo

3 1 día(s)

Frecuencia
1 veces por día(s)
esperada

Importancia vital

Urgencia inmediatamente

Estado en construcción

Estabilidad media

Comentarios Este caso de uso corresponde al requerimiento control de


campeonatos.

UC-0002 Asesoria de Campeonatos

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io


Dependencias  [FRQ-0002] Asesoría de campeonatos

Descripción El sistema deberá comportarse tal como se describe en el


siguiente caso de uso cuando El sistema debe tener un lugar,
donde cualquier persona que necite informacion sobre un
campeonato, pueda ingresar.

Precondición El sistema tiene una pagina donde brinde la informacion sobre


los torneos, que realizaran.

Secuencia Paso Acción


normal
1 El sistema tiene un entorno en linea, donde se
encuentra la informacion de los torneos.

2 El actor Participante (ACT-0002) explora las opciones


de "Información de Campeonatos".

Postcondición El usuario ingresa al entorno del sistema donde se encuentra


la informacion, y se informa sobre lo que desee.

Excepciones Paso Acción

1 Si el sistema no tiene habilitado esta opcion, el


actor usuario (ACT-0003) no podra visualizar la
informacion, a continuación este caso de uso queda sin
efecto

Rendimiento Paso Tiempo máximo

- -

Frecuencia
6 veces por día(s)
esperada

Importancia vital

Urgencia inmediatamente

Estado en construcción
Estabilidad media

Comentarios Este caso de uso se relaciona con el requerimiento Asesoria


de Campeonatos

UC-0003 actualizacion de la informacion

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[FRQ-0001] Actualización de Información

Descripción El sistema deberá comportarse tal como se describe en el


siguiente caso de uso cuando El sistema debera dejar
actualizar la informacion

Precondición La informacion esta incompleta.

Secuencia Paso Acción


normal
1 El actor Administrador del sistema (ACT-
0001) Selecciona la opción de "Gestión de Información".

2 El actor Administrador del sistema (ACT-0001) Actualiza


los datos de equipos, jugadores y resultados de
partidas.

3 El sistema Confirma y guarda la información


actualizada

Postcondición La informacion esta actualizada.

Excepciones Paso Acción

1 Si Si el usuario no está autorizado,


, el sistema mostrara un mensaje de error., a
continuación este caso de uso PD
Rendimiento Paso Tiempo máximo

- -

Frecuencia
1 veces por semana(s)
esperada

Importancia importante

Urgencia hay presión

Estado en construcción

Estabilidad media

Comentarios Este caso de uso corresponde al requisito Actualizacion de la


informacion

UC-0004 Preservacion de la informacion

Versión 1.0 ( 22/11/2023 )

Autores  Federico Medina Parra

Fuentes  Representante del colegio

Dependencias  [FRQ-0003] Preservación de Información

Descripción El sistema deberá comportarse tal como se describe en el


siguiente caso de uso cuando El sistema debe almacenar
automáticamente los datos de jugadores, equipos, resultados
y premiaciones.

Precondición No esta guardada la informacion.

Secuencia Paso Acción


normal
1 El sistema Guarda la informacion nueva.

Postcondición La información actualizada ya esta guardada.

Excepciones Paso Acción


- -

Rendimiento Paso Tiempo máximo

- -

Frecuencia
1 veces por semana(s)
esperada

Importancia vital

Urgencia inmediatamente

Estado en construcción

Estabilidad media

Comentarios Ninguno
Diagrama de caso de uso
Conclusión
Una gestión efectiva de requisitos es fundamental para el éxito de cualquier
proyecto de software. Ya que proporciona la base necesaria para su diseño
Conclusiones Bibliografía
Weitzenfeld, A. (2013). Modelo de Requisitos. En Ingeniería de Software Orientada
a Objetos con UML, Java e Internet (pp. 195-234). Cengage Learning.
https://link.gale.com/apps/doc/CX3004300051/GPS?u=unad&sid=bookmark-
GPS&xid=59a5837d

Piattini Velthuis, M. & Garzás Parra, J. (2015). 6. Gestión de requisitos. En


Fábricas de software: experiencias, tecnologías y organización (pp. 212 –
255). RA-MA Editorial.
https://elibro-net.bibliotecavirtual.unad.edu.co/es/ereader/unad/106389?
page=212

También podría gustarte